Amy:
Matthew records similar words in Mathew 10:29-31 when he quotes Jesus, saying, “Don’t be afraid of those who want to kill your body; they cannot touch your soul. Fear only God, who can destroy both soul and body in hell. What is the price of two sparrows—one copper coin? But not a single sparrow can fall to the ground without your Father knowing it. And the very hairs on your head are all numbered. So don’t be afraid; you are more valuable to God than a whole flock of sparrows.”

Christgazer, there’s so much more to you than your body. Though your body may betray you, though the people of this world may betray your body, only God has the power to destroy your inner man, but his heart is that you would not perish (1 Peter 3:9).

Though people in the world around you disrespect life, placing little value on a sparrow, and less on a child, God wants you to understand how important you truly are. You matter very much to him. For if he numbers every hair on your head, he is close, aware of every strand that falls out due to stress, sickness, and old age.

You are worth the very life of his only son. Can we comprehend it?
